1. meat platter (replacing wolf jerky)
2. blood pudding
3. lox meat pie
the honey glazed chicken is the same as meat platter, but meat platter uses seeker meat, hare meat, and lox meat, which are all easily renewable. chicken meat must be "grown," which is more micro and base space than just going out and killing the right mobs.
the problem with mushroom omelette is its only a 25 minute food, so it doesnt sync up with the 30 minute foods.
so, unless you dont want to use the meat platter, i would say chickens are pretty irrelevant. if you dont use meat platter, then i would favor chicken meat over eggs. 3 eggs to make 1 omelette isnt as good as 1 chicken to make 1 honey glazed chicken.
Seekers hit like a truck, but are easy to deal with as long as you get the first crack at them with the atgeir. I've only fought the no-stars and 1-stars so far. But one secondary swipe followed by a jab (or two with the no-stars) is a pretty easy method. I just have to avoid that initial death from above lol.
Parrying them with sword and board is doable also but I do take shots here and there and it can sometimes wreck me. Atgeir is awesome, at least before the new weapons, which I haven't gotten to yet.
